British Chambers of Commerce: Unfilled vacancies ‘a ticking timebomb’

The British Chambers of Commerce (BCC) has called for Government action to alleviate pressure on the labour market, describing the shortage of available staff "a ticking timebomb for firms up and down the country". Sheffield Futures seeks 18-24s referrals for Pathways to Success employment support project

Sheffield Futures has a new employment support project aimed at supporting unemployed and economically inactive 18-24-year-olds into work, education and/or training. The project is being delivered as part of Sheffield City Council's Pathways to Success project, part-funded by the European Social Fund. Govt pledges £7.6 million to help 2,000 adults with autism into work

From: Department for Work and Pensions and Chloe Smith MP A new £7.6 million government initiative has been launched to help over 2,000 adults with learning disabilities and autism move into work.
